If you’re a shopaholic, you know Vaughan Mills is the ultimate place for shopping. But if you don’t live in the Vaughan area, it could mean a long drive or bus ride (TTC and a transfer to a York Region/VIVA bus) just to get there.
Now getting to Vaughan Mills has just become a lot easier.
The mall is offering FREE round trip transportation to Vaughan Mills twice a day, seven days a week. You’ll be travelling first class on a luxury motor coach bus, leaving Union Station in Toronto for Vaughan Mills every day at 10 a.m. and 1 p.m.
What to expect? BIG SAVINGS from outlet stores galore. There are lots of great coffee shops, restaurants, and entertainment establishments to keep you busy for the day.
Outlet stores include: Browns, Nine West, Benetton, Gap Factory, Marciano, A/X Armani Exchange, Banana Republic Factory Store, Tommy Hilfiger, Nike, Adidas, Holt Renfrew Last Call Disney Store.
Vaughan Mills is located at: 1 Bass Pro Mills Drive, Vaughan (at Highway 400 and Rutherford Rd. Across from Canada’s Wonderland). For more information, please call: 905-879-2110.
*Free transportation service is available until October 22, 2009.
